HKUST, SEMI to Host 2025 Semiconductor Summit in HK

The Hong Kong University of Science and Technology (HKUST) is pleased to partner with SEMI to co-host the inaugural Semiconductor Innovation and Intelligent Application Summit (SIIAS) on December 2, 2025. Supported by the HKSAR Government, this landmark event will be held in Hong Kong for the first time, bringing together global industry leaders, pioneering researchers, and key policymakers to shape the future of semiconductor innovation and drive the industry's strategic development. The SIIAS will further establish Hong Kong as a global innovation hub for microelectronics and advanced manufacturing.

Prof. SUN Dong, Secretary for Innovation, Technology and Industry of the HKSAR Government, along with Mr. Lung CHU, Corporate Vice President of SEMI, will address the Summit by offering their distinctive perspectives on semiconductor industry development. The day-long event will also include insightful plenary sessions and industry-focused discussions, featuring key industry leaders from Chinese Mainland, the United States, Saudi Arabia, Germany, Singapore and etc.

The event will also feature an interactive innovation zone showcasing cutting-edge technological achievements from 12 research teams across HKUST and HKUST (Guangzhou). This vibrant exhibition will vividly illustrate how semiconductor technology is propelling global progress. Additionally, a series of specially designed STEM workshops will provide secondary school students with immersive, hands-on experiences to explore the exciting applications of artificial intelligence and semiconductor technology.

Founded in 1970, SEMI is one of the world's largest trade association serving the global semiconductor industry. Connecting over 3,000 member companies and 1.5 million industry professionals worldwide, SEMI accelerates collaboration through advocacy, talent development, sustainability initiatives, supply-chain resilience, and a broad portfolio of programs designed to tackle the sector's most pressing challenges. Each year, SEMI hosts major forums and exhibitions around the world, driving industry progress and convening top experts to spur innovation.
